Transaction 1f5acd74ca114b61d8c4f0c913af336429eb624957e45e181bcebb30e9dddd17
1 Input
1 Output
-
1f5acd74ca114b61d8c4f0c913af336429eb624957e45e181bcebb30e9dddd17:0
- value
- 51038612
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15942c39cffe59193e2448d4c12390a5ba9438b2 OP_EQUAL
- address
- 33f7co7UtuxbUBzfKXqZ8L1SvqJ5YCT57u